Output 5f8fc63cbae599aedfce21f05b24d8dd7dd9d180f58669b2762700050f4c1103:1

value
1327716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c07679b87905b7aa9353775a631be8d3f5c1105 OP_EQUAL
address
34FDiQNVkWsHhGHtHFPDc2PuHTQyHfBsHA
transaction
5f8fc63cbae599aedfce21f05b24d8dd7dd9d180f58669b2762700050f4c1103
spent
true